825617-73-0
Benzamide,N-[3-(5,6-dimethoxy-1H-benzimidazol-2-yl)-1H-pyrazol-4-yl]-2-ethoxy-4-nitro-
Product Code:
931249
Molecular Formula:
C21H20N6O6
Molecular Weight:
Order 825617-73-0